What is the AWS Certified Solutions Architect – Associate?

The AWS Certified Solutions Architect – Associate represents a rigorous validation of an individual’s ability to design and deploy well-architected solutions on the Amazon Web Services platform. It exists to ensure that engineers move beyond mere technical knowledge and into the realm of architectural strategy, focusing on the five pillars of the Well-Architected Framework. This certification emphasizes real-world, production-focused learning, requiring candidates to understand how different services interact to form a resilient system. It aligns perfectly with modern engineering workflows where infrastructure is treated as code and security is baked into the design from day one. In an enterprise setting, this credential proves that a professional can handle high-availability requirements and optimize costs effectively.

AWS Certified Solutions Architect – Associate Certification Tracks & Levels

The AWS certification ecosystem is organized into foundational, associate, professional, and specialty levels to guide career progression. The foundational level provides a basic overview, while the associate level, where this certification sits, focuses on implementation and design logic. Professional levels demand deeper experience in complex migrations and multi-account strategies, suitable for senior roles. Specialization tracks allow professionals to pivot into focused domains such as DevOps, SRE, Security, or FinOps after mastering the associate-level concepts. This tiered structure ensures that as an engineer’s responsibilities grow, their certification path supports their journey toward leadership or deep technical expertise.

Detailed Guide for Each AWS Certified Solutions Architect – Associate Certification

AWS Certified Solutions Architect – Associate

What it is This certification validates your ability to design and deploy effectively secured and robust applications on AWS technologies. It confirms you can define a solution using architectural design principles based on customer requirements.

Who should take it Suitable for individuals in a solutions architect role or those performing cloud design tasks with at least one year of hands-on experience. It is ideal for those intending to demonstrate their capability to build and deploy well-architected cloud systems.

Skills you’ll gain

  • Designing resilient and high-availability architectures.
  • Implementing secure tiers for applications.
  • Optimizing storage and database performance.
  • Managing identity and access management for cloud resources.
  • Understanding cost estimation and cost-control mechanisms.

Real-world projects you should be able to do

  • Designing a multi-tier web application that scales automatically.
  • Migrating an on-premise database to a managed cloud environment.
  • Setting up a disaster recovery plan across multiple geographical regions.
  • Implementing a secure VPC with private and public subnets.

Preparation plan

  • 7-14 days: Focus on high-level service overviews, understanding the core compute (EC2), storage (S3), and networking (VPC) components.
  • 30 days: Deep dive into database services (RDS, DynamoDB), IAM policies, and the Well-Architected Framework pillars through hands-on labs.
  • 60 days: Take multiple practice exams, review whitepapers on security and best practices, and work on building a complete end-to-end serverless architecture.

Common mistakes

  • Focusing too much on memorizing service names rather than understanding how they interact.
  • Neglecting the cost optimization and security pillars of the Well-Architected Framework.
  • Skipping hands-on practice in favor of just reading documentation or watching videos.

Best next certification after this

  • Same-track option: AWS Certified Solutions Architect – Professional.
  • Cross-track option: AWS Certified DevOps Engineer – Professional.

Frequently Asked Questions (General)

  1. What is the difficulty level of this certification?
    The associate level is considered moderately difficult, requiring a solid grasp of core services and architectural logic rather than just rote memorization.
  2. How long does it take to prepare for the exam?
    Most professionals with some IT background find that 6 to 8 weeks of consistent study is sufficient to cover all the necessary domains deeply.
  3. Are there any hard prerequisites for the associate exam?
    There are no formal prerequisites, but having a basic understanding of networking, storage, and compute concepts is highly recommended before starting.
  4. What is the validity period of the certification?
    The certification is valid for three years, after which you must recertify to maintain your active status and prove your knowledge is current.
  5. Does this certification help in getting a salary hike?
    Yes, it is globally recognized as a high-value credential that often leads to better job opportunities and significant salary increases in the cloud market.
  6. Can I take the exam online from my home?
    Yes, AWS offers proctored online exams that you can take from your home or office, provided you meet the technical and environment requirements.
  7. How many questions are there in the actual exam?
    The exam typically consists of 65 multiple-choice or multiple-response questions that must be completed within 130 minutes.
  8. What is the passing score for the associate level?
    The passing score is 720 out of 1000, based on a scaled scoring model that accounts for the difficulty of individual questions.
  9. Is hands-on experience mandatory to pass?
    While not strictly mandatory, it is extremely difficult to pass without hands-on experience because the questions are scenario-based and practical.
  10. Which services should I focus on the most?
    You should prioritize EC2, S3, VPC, IAM, and RDS, as these form the foundation of almost every architectural question on the exam.
  11. Are practice exams worth the investment?
    Absolutely, practice exams are crucial for understanding the phrasing of questions and managing your time effectively during the actual test.
  12. Should I skip the Practitioner exam and go straight to Associate?
    If you already have a basic understanding of IT, skipping the Practitioner level is common and allows you to dive straight into more technical content.

FAQs on AWS Certified Solutions Architect – Associate

Is the AWS Certified Solutions Architect – Associate still relevant today?
Yes, it remains one of the most sought-after certifications because it covers the foundational architectural principles that every cloud professional must know. Organizations continue to prioritize hiring individuals who can design secure and cost-effective systems.

What is the best way to start learning for someone with no cloud experience?
The best way is to start with the official AWS documentation and whitepapers while simultaneously setting up a free-tier account to practice launching services. Following a structured course from a reputable provider can also provide the necessary roadmap.

How does this certification differ from the SysOps or Developer Associate?
While the Solutions Architect exam focuses on design and broad system structure, the SysOps exam focuses on deployment and operations, and the Developer exam focuses on using AWS services within code.

Are there many job opportunities for this certification in India?
India has a massive demand for cloud talent, and this certification is a standard requirement for many roles in major tech hubs like Bangalore, Hyderabad, and Pune.

Can I move into a DevOps role after getting this certification?
Yes, this certification provides the architectural foundation required for DevOps, though you will also need to learn automation tools and CI/CD practices to fully transition.

What are the most important whitepapers to read for the exam?
You must read the AWS Well-Architected Framework and the whitepapers on Security Best Practices and Overview of Amazon Web Services to understand the core philosophy.

How often does AWS update the exam content?
AWS updates the exam periodically to include new services and best practices, so it is important to ensure your study materials are current for the latest version.

Is it better to specialize in a specific AWS service after the associate level?

Specialization is highly recommended after the associate level, as it allows you to become an expert in high-demand areas like security, data, or networking.
